Check Digit Verification of cas no

The CAS Registry Mumber 80486-69-7 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 8,0,4,8 and 6 respectively; the second part has 2 digits, 6 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 80486-69:
(7*8)+(6*0)+(5*4)+(4*8)+(3*6)+(2*6)+(1*9)=147
147 % 10 = 7
So 80486-69-7 is a valid CAS Registry Number.

PROCESS FOR SYNTHESIS OF ANDROSTANE 17-BETA CARBOTHIOIC ACID AND RELATIVE COMPOUNDS THEREOF

-

Page/Page column 4, (2009/12/02)

A process for synthesis of androstane 17-β carbothioic acid is provided. The process includes mixing an androstane 17-β carboxylic acid and a coupling reagent, and adding an alkanethioic acid to form an androstane 17-β carbothioic acid, wherein the androstane 17-β carbothioic acid has the formula (I): wherein R1 represents hydrogen or haloalkyl groups, R2 represents C1-8 linear alkyl groups, C1-8 branched alkyl groups, C1-6 unsaturated acyclic groups or aromatic groups, R3 represents hydrogen or hydroxyl, R4 represents hydrogen, bromine, chlorine or fluorine and R5 represents hydrogen, bromine, chlorine or fluorine. The process is a one-pot reaction.

Synthesis and structure-activity relationships in a series of antiinflammatory corticosteroid analogues, halomethyl androstane-17β- carbothioates and -17β-carboselenoates

Phillipps,Bailey,Bain,Borella,Buckton,Clark,Doherty,English,Fazakerley,Laing,Lane-Allman,Robinson,Sandford,Sharratt,Steeples,Stonehouse,Williamson

, p. 3717 - 3729 (2007/10/02)

The preparation and topical antiinflammatory potencies of a series of halomethyl 17α-(acyloxy)-11β-hydroxy-3-oxoandrosta-1,4-diene-17β- carbothioates, carrying combinations of 6α-fluoro, 9α-fluoro, 16-methyl, and 16-methylene substituents, are described. Key synthetic stages were the preparation of carbothioic acids and their reaction with dihalomethanes. The carbothioic acids were formed from 17β-carboxylic acids by initial reaction with dimethylthiocarbamoyl chloride followed by aminolysis of the resulting rearranged mixed anhydride with diethylamine, or by carboxyl activation with 1,1'-carbonyldiimidazole (CDI) or 2-fluoro-N-methylpyridinium tosylate (FMPT) and reaction with hydrogen sulfide, the choice of reagent being governed by the 17α-substituent. Carboxyl activation with FMPT and reaction with sodium hydrogen selenide led to the halomethyl 16-methyleneandrostane-17β- carboselenoate analogues. Anti-inflammatory potencies were measured in humans using the vasoconstriction assay and in rats and mice by a modification the Tonelli croton oil ear assay. Best activities were shown by fluoromethyl and chloromethyl carbothioates with a 17α-propionyloxy group. S-Fluoromethyl 6α,9α-difluoro-11β-hydroxy-16α-methyl-3-oxo-17α-(propionyloxy)androsta- 1,4-diene-17β-carbothioate (fluticasone propionate, FP) was selected for clinical study as it showed high topical antiinflammatory activity but caused little hypothalamic-pituitary-adrenal suppression after topical or oral administration to rodents.

ANDROSTANE CARBOTHIOATES

-

, (2008/06/13)

Compounds of the formula wherein R1 represents a fluoro-, chloro- or bromo-methyl group or a 2'-fluoroethyl group, R2 represents a group COR6 where R6 is a C 1-3 alkyl group or OR2 and R3 together form a 16alpha,17alpha-isopropylidenedioxy group; R3 represents a hydrogen atom, a methyl group (which may be in either the alpha- or beta -configuration) or a methylene group; R4 represents a hydrogen, chlorine or fluorine atom; R5 represents a hydrogen or fluorine atom and symbol represents a single or double bond have good anti-inflammatory activity, particularly on topical applications. The compounds of formula I are prepared by esterification, halogenation, reduction, deprotection and reaction at a 9,11-double bond to form a 9alpha-halo-11 beta-hydroxy grouping. Pharmaceutical compositions containing the compounds of formula I and methods for the use of the compounds are described and claimed
